Find out more about the symptoms of atrial … Web5 de mar. de 2024 · To start with is the simple measurement of heart rate from the ECG. Normal range of heart rate is taken as 60-100/min in an adult in the resting state. A new born infant can have a resting heart rate around 140/min. Resting heart rate comes down gradually as age advances, to reach the adult range. ECG waves and normal heart rate. Web10 de ago. de 2024 · The normal heart rate has been considered to be between 60 and 100 beats per minute, although there is some disagreement with regard to the normal rate in adults. The range (defined by 1st and 99 th percentiles) is between 43 and 102 beats per minute in men and between 47 and 103 beats per minute in women ( table 1 ) [ 1-3 ].
